<p>There have some astronomical changes over the past 2 days in the NFC East. Things are heating up for the Best Division in Football and just about underway. The division consists of the Washington Redskins, New York Giants, Philadelphia Eagles, and Dallas Cowboys; 3 of which reached the playoffs while the Eagles had an 8-8 record missing the playoffs.</p>
<p><span id="more-62"></span></p>
<p>The Washington Redskins got a devastating injury to defensive end Philip Daniels for the season on Day 1 of practice; 5 Hours later Jason Taylor joins the team and agrees with a deal. How does this happen? Taylor has been on the market for months(kind of considering Parcells lied and said Taylor will be a Dolphin at the beginning of the season) and the Redskins go from a terrible injury to bringing in a former defensive MVP in just hours! This was an unbelievable move for the organization, and the team. Now on a side note for the Redskins, as I was driving to work listening to Mike-and-Mike in the morning, Mike Greenberg GUARANTEED that Favre will be playing in Washington by the start of the season. He said this is the most reasonable location for him and that the trade will happen. I personally agree with what he said 100%(although as an Eagles fan I would hate to see this happen), Todd Collins had a magical run last year but it won&#8217;t last forever. Brett is the perfect match for this team and would thrive with all the weapons. This was a great trade for the Dolphins, because it gives Parcells the opportunity to use these draft picks for the future and build the team HE wants, not what he gets. The Dolphins have no use for Taylor this season, nor next season. But in 3 years when Parcells has the team he wants, it will have been well worth this Dolphin drought.</p>
<p>In New York, the Giants have parted ways with big-mouth under-producing tight end Jeremy Shockey. The Giants recieved a second round and a fifth round draft pick(2009) in the trade of the &#8220;superstar&#8221;. I think this was a great move for the Giants, it is time to move on and start giving the rock to 6&#8217;6 &#8211; 253 Kevin Boss. The guy is a giant(no pun intended) and showed glimpses of the player they have in him last season. Do not get me wrong, Shockey has been a very good player for the Giants the past few seasons, but I felt he was being held back from his potential many times(maybe because of injuries, maybe the quarterback), but this move is a great move for both teams.</p>
<p>In Philly, things were quiet and then could suddenly turn bad after the past week. Philadelphia&#8217;s #1 best athlete Brian Westbrook want&#8217;s more money. PAY HIM. Brian is the 13th highest paid running back in the National Football League, and is #3 in stats. Brian has rightfully deserved a new contract and rightfully deserves to be paid top 5. Lito Sheppard signed Drew Rosenhaus, but they report that Lito WILL be playing this season and looking for a contract after this year) I will be happy with this, as long as there are no problems with him in the locker room(I don&#8217;t expect any). Lastly, we signed WR DeSean Jackson on a 4 year deal who is expected to compete for the #3 receiver and the primary return-man. Jackson has deadly speed and we expect him to turn some heads this year. 			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p style="text-align: left;"><img class="alignleft" style="float: left;" src="http://upxload.com/images/3yis6e15qjkcpv8vvuab.jpg" alt="Jason Taylor Packers" width="295" height="276" />I am sorry Green Bay, but this is not real YET. But the possiblity of <em>Dancing with the Star&#8217;s</em> runner up Jason Taylor becoming a Green Bay Packer seems like the perfect fit. Reports say that the fish might accept a 2nd round draftpick in exchange.</p>
<p style="text-align: left;">Kabeer Gbaja-Biamila is coming of knee surgery, and at the defensive end position without a healthy knee, your useless. The legendary Brett Favre is no longer in the NFL, and unproven youngster Aaron Rodgers is stepping up into the starting roll. The Packs primary pass rusher Corey Williams was traded after his temporary franchise-tag.</p>
<p style="text-align: left;"><span id="more-17"></span></p>
<p style="text-align: left;">The tandem of former defensive mvp Jason Taylor and pro-bowler Aaron Kampman could be a nasty duo that offensive coordinators fear. Also, the defensive coordinator of the Packers is Bob Sanders, a former member of Dave Wannstedt&#8217;s Staff. Robert Nunn is also a former member of Dave Wannstedt&#8217;s staff, and is now the defensive tackle coach.For the Dolphins, this trade will remove any bickering problems between the Tuna and Jason Taylor.The Packers recently have been known for going after every big name player on the market.. But this is a possibility that will help the organization immensly for the next two years.</p>
